The cartesian plane is divided into four regions, or quadrants. Each quadrant is labeled based on the signs of the x and y coordinates of points within it. The quadrants are referred to as the first quadrant, second quadrant, third quadrant, and fourth quadrant.

Each quadrant is defined by the signs of the x and y coordinates of points within it. The four quadrants are labeled as follows:

First Quadrant (+, +): This quadrant is located in the upper right portion of the Cartesian plane. It contains points with positive x-coordinates (to the right of the origin) and positive y-coordinates (above the origin). In this quadrant, both x and y values are positive.

Second Quadrant (-, +): Positioned in the upper left portion of the coordinate plane, this quadrant contains points with negative x-coordinates (to the left of the origin) and positive y-coordinates (above the origin). Here, x values are negative, while y values remain positive.

Third Quadrant (-, -): Found in the lower left part of the Cartesian plane, this quadrant consists of points with negative x-coordinates (to the left of the origin) and negative y-coordinates (below the origin). In the third quadrant, both x and y values are negative.

Fourth Quadrant (+, -): Situated in the lower right section of the coordinate plane, this quadrant contains points with positive x-coordinates (to the right of the origin) and negative y-coordinates (below the origin). Here, x values are positive, while y values are negative.

These quadrants provide a systematic way to locate and identify points in the Cartesian plane, facilitating mathematical operations, graphing functions, and analyzing geometric relationships. Each quadrant has its own unique characteristics and significance in various mathematical applications.

The value of y varies directly with x. if `x=4` when `y=28`, what is the value of y when `x=10`?

Answers

To find the value of y when x is 10, we can use the direct variation equation.  So, by using the direct variation equation we know that then x is 10, and the value of y is 70.

To find the value of y when x is 10, we can use the direct variation equation.

In this case, the equation would be y = kx, where k is the constant of variation.

To solve for k, we can use the given values. When x is 4, y is 28.

Plugging these values into the equation, we get [tex]28 = k * 4.[/tex]
Simplifying this equation, we find that [tex]k = 7.[/tex]

Now that we have the value of k, we can substitute it back into the equation y = kx.
When x is 10,

[tex]y = 7 * 10 \\= 70.[/tex]

Therefore, when x is 10, the value of y is 70.

Find the circumference of a circle with diameter, d = 28cm. give your answer in terms of pi .

Answers

The circumference of the circle with diameter d=28 cm is 28π cm.

The formula for finding the circumference of a circle is C = πd

where C is the circumference and d is the diameter.

Therefore, using the given diameter d = 28 cm, the circumference of the circle can be calculated as follows:

C = πd = π(28 cm) = 28π cm

The circumference of the circle with diameter d = 28 cm is 28π cm.

Identify each system as linear-quadratic or quadratic-quadratic. Then solve.

9 x²+4 y²=36

x²-y²=4

Answers

The given system is a quadratic-quadratic system, and the solutions are (x, y) = (2, 0) and (x, y) = (-2, 0).

The given system consists of two equations:

Equation 1: 9x² + 4y² = 36

Equation 2: x² - y² = 4

Both equations contain terms with variables raised to the power of 2, which indicates a quadratic equation. Hence, the system is a quadratic-quadratic system.

To solve the system, we can use the method of substitution. Rearrange Equation 2 to solve for x²:

x² = y² + 4

Substitute this expression for x² in Equation 1:

9(y² + 4) + 4y² = 36

9y² + 36 + 4y² = 36

13y² + 36 = 36

13y² = 0

y² = 0

Taking the square root of both sides, we get:

y = 0

Substitute this value of y into Equation 2:

x² - 0² = 4

x² = 4

x = ±2

Therefore, the solutions to the system are (x, y) = (2, 0) and (x, y) = (-2, 0).

Therefore, the system is a quadratic-quadratic system, and the solutions are (x, y) = (2, 0) and (x, y) = (-2, 0).

A relation is symmetric if for every (a, b) in the relation, (b, a) is also in the relation. In this case, for the relation to be symmetric, every element (a, b) in the relation must have its corresponding element (b, a) in the relation.

In option A, {(a,b)|a=b}, every element (a, b) in the relation is such that a is equal to b. For example, (1, 1), (2, 2), and (3, 3) are all part of the relation. Since the relation includes the corresponding elements (b, a) as well, it is symmetric.
